    I was staying next-door at the Home2 suites and the front desk said this was a great place, so I…read morefigured I'd try it out. It's sort of Italian and sort of steak and sort of a little bit of everything. Really clean, strait forward , reasonable menu, nice ambience. It feels kind of high end but the pricing is definitely mid range. I selected the tomato basil soup as my appetizer. It came with a nice toasted crustini. It was a really good soup. It tasted fresh. It had a lot of body to it like, maybe they did the tomatoes here in the house from fresh. It was definitely tomato. The basil was kind in the background, but it was a true red sauce. It was almost tomato paste or tomato sauce flavor. I would've not complained if they given it to me over a bit of penne.. It had a really nice flavor on it not too sweet not too acidic really a very good soup. It came out in a footed coffee cup so you're getting about one cup of soup. The main course was the broiled seafood platter. It was anchored by a large piece of mahi-mahi, that was amazingly well prepared, firm and tasty. To the side of that was a wonderful crabcake, one of the best I've had anywhere and definitely the best in the Carolinas. It did not have too much breading and it had a wonderful texture with lots of good crab flavor. Drizzled across all of this were scallops and shrimp. The shrimp were a little overcooked if you asked me. The scallops were sweet and perfect and everything you would want them to be. The side that comes with this is their crab fries which essentially our beer battered french fries dusted with old bay seasoning. If you've ever had the crab fries at the Philadelphia, ballpark, this is the way they do it. For dessert, I ordered the lemon cello mascarpone cake. It comes drizzled with raspberry sauce. I had visions of lemon curd, and what I got was really good and really lemonade and good cake. But it's not a very big slice. I know about the weight staff. I don't know if they're all good, but mine was exceptional and lovely to talk with. The place was very busy. It had a nice vibe to it, it could've been in South Beach or Miami or Los Angeles, not that it was over over the top just that it was very clean and nice and well done. This is a professional restaurant not some amateur attempt. I recommend it.
